    [Adjective]  | "fond" | \ ˈfänd \


    1: foolish, silly

    2: prizing highly : desirous —used with of

    3: having an affection or liking —used with of


    Origin: 14th century ;

     Middle English fonned, fond, from fonne fool;

    [Verb]  | "fond" 


    1: to lavish affection : dote


    Origin: 1530 ;

     See: ;

    [Noun]  | "fond" | \ ˈfōⁿ \


    1: background, basis

    2: small particles of browned food and especially meat that adhere to the bottom of a cooking pan and are used especially in making sauces

    3: fund


    Origin: 1664 ;

     Borrowed from French, going back to Old French funt, font "bottom, base" {mat|fund:1|};
